Pairing Your JVC Earbuds

Pairing your JVC earbuds with your device is a simple process. Start by putting your earbuds into pairing mode. This typically involves pressing and holding the designated button on the earbuds for a few seconds until you see a flashing LED light, indicating that they are ready to pair.

Next, access the Bluetooth settings on your device. You should see a list of available devices; look for your JVC earbuds in this list. Once you find them, tap on the name to initiate the pairing process. Your device may ask for confirmation; if so, approve the request. Upon successful pairing, you’ll receive a notification, and you can begin enjoying your audio.

Troubleshooting Common Connection Issues

Even with straightforward connection steps, issues can sometimes arise. One of the most common problems is low battery levels. To ensure optimal performance, check the battery levels of both your earbuds and the device you are attempting to connect. If either device is low on power, charge them before trying to pair again.

Another potential issue could be interference from other devices. If multiple Bluetooth devices are connected to your device, they may interfere with the pairing process. To resolve this, disconnect other devices and try pairing your JVC earbuds again. If problems persist, consider restarting both the earbuds and the device. This often resolves temporary glitches that might be hindering the connection.

Maintaining Your JVC Earbuds

To ensure the longevity and performance of your JVC earbuds, regular maintenance is essential. Start by cleaning your earbuds frequently to prevent dirt and sweat buildup, especially if you use them during workouts. Use a soft cloth and a mild solution to wipe the exterior and avoid using harsh chemicals that could damage the materials.

Proper storage is equally important. When not in use, store your earbuds in a protective case to prevent physical damage. Avoid leaving them in extreme temperatures, such as a hot car or a damp area, as these conditions can adversely affect battery life and audio quality. Following these maintenance tips will help prolong the lifespan of your earbuds and keep them performing at their best.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I connect JVC earbuds to my smartphone?

To connect JVC earbuds to your smartphone, first ensure that the earbuds are fully charged. Then, turn on Bluetooth on your smartphone and put the earbuds in pairing mode by pressing and holding the power button until the LED indicator flashes. Look for your JVC earbuds in the list of available devices on your smartphone and select them to complete the connection.

What should I do if my JVC earbuds won’t connect to Bluetooth?

If your JVC earbuds won’t connect to Bluetooth, start by ensuring they are charged and in pairing mode. Then, try turning off Bluetooth on your device and restarting it. If the issue persists, forget the earbuds from your Bluetooth settings and attempt to reconnect them, as this can often resolve connection problems.

Why are my JVC earbuds not producing sound after connecting?

If your JVC earbuds are connected but not producing sound, first check the volume level on both the earbuds and your connected device. Ensure that the earbuds are securely placed in your ears, as a poor fit can affect sound quality. Additionally, verify that the correct audio output device is selected in your device’s settings.

How can I reset my JVC earbuds to factory settings?

To reset your JVC earbuds to factory settings, first, ensure they are powered off. Then, press and hold the power button for about 10 seconds until you see the LED indicator flashing red and blue. This process will clear all previous connections, allowing you to start fresh with the pairing process.
